  • Patent number: 11634185
    Abstract: A vehicle storage system may include a deck configured to span substantially a total width of a vehicle bed, and a drawer assembly including a supporting frame and a tub, the drawer assembly configured to extend, via a guide channel assembly, in a longitudinal direction of the vehicle bed past the deck, and configured to retract, via the guide channel assembly, under the deck, the drawer assembly configured to detach from the guide channel assembly and be removed from the vehicle bed, the deck configured to rotate between a closed position and an open position relative to the drawer assembly. The vehicle storage system may further include a cart affixed to a bottom portion of the drawer assembly.

  • Patent number: 11160419
    Abstract: Grinders, analyzers, and related technologies are described herein. The grinders can hold foodstuff that is periodically ground. The analyzers can analyze the foodstuff to determine information about the state of the foodstuff. Algorithms can be used to determine how to process the foodstuff, how to use the foodstuff, and/or when to discard the foodstuff. The grinder can be a portable, rechargeable electric coffee grinder configured to monitor the freshness of the coffee beans. When coffee beans become stale, they can be discarded and the coffee grinder can be refilled with fresh coffee beans.

  • Patent number: 11059433
    Abstract: This disclosure describes systems, devices, apparatuses, kits, and methods of accessing a container. In a particular implementation, a container includes a housing that defines a cavity and a ladder coupled to the housing. The ladder is movable relative to the housing while the ladder is coupled to the housing. The ladder is movable relative to the housing between: a first position in which the ladder is disposed within the cavity; and a second position in which the ladder is disposed outside the cavity.

  • Patent number: 10004360
    Abstract: A pair of tongs, comprises: first and second arms, each arm having a gripping end and a pivot end. A hinge pivotably joins the first and second arms at the pivot ends thereof. A spring is coupled to each of the first and second arms, the spring being biased to urge the first and second arms apart, from a first, closed position, to a second, open, position. A releasable lock locks the first and second arms in the closed position, the releasable lock being operable by a single hand of a user.

  • Publication number: 20180050849
    Abstract: A travel receptacle comprising a receptacle for holding a liquid and a lid for selectively closing the receptacle. The lid includes a first piece for engaging the top of the receptacle, the first piece having an impermeable portion which blocks the passage of the liquid therethrough and a first opening for allowing the passage of the liquid therethrough; and a second piece having an impermeable portion which blocks the passage of the liquid therethrough and a second opening for allowing the passage of the liquid therethrough. At least one of the first piece and the second piece is movable with respect to the other, between an open position in which the first and second openings align to allow passage of the liquid therethrough and a closed position in which the first and second openings are not aligned, thereby blocking passage of the liquid.

  • Publication number: 20060226103
    Abstract: Closure member control systems, including door control systems for barrier housings, and associated methods are disclosed. One aspect of the invention is directed toward a closure member control system that includes a closure member positioned to cover a portion of an opening in a structure (e.g., a barrier housing). The closure member has a closed position where the closure member covers the portion of the opening and an open position where the closure member does not cover the portion of the opening. The system further includes a control device operatively coupled to the closure member that urges the closure member to remain in the closed position when the closure member is in the closed position and urges the closure member to remain in the open position when the closure member is in the open position. In certain embodiments, the control device can include at least one forcing mechanism.
